Courtship dance, Blue Footed Boobies, Punta Saurez, Espanola Island, The Galapagos, Ecuador, 2012

The behavior of the Blue Footed Booby is most clown-like during courtship. It appeared to me that this pair was engaged in a courtship dance, as they shuffled their huge blue feet from side to side, virtually mimicking each other's moves. I photographed them above, something I rarely do with birds, since a high vantage point often tends to diminish them in scale. But in this case, an overhead viewpoint was warranted -- I am able to stress the color and position of the feet, which tell the story here.
